bain-marie

Meaning

Noun

  • A large pan containing hot water, into which other smaller pans are set in order to cook food slowly, or to keep food warm.

Related

Similar words

Origin

  • Borrowed from French bain-marie, from Medieval Latin balneum Mariae.
